I am currently representing a nationwide fire & security specialist company, who carry out a variety of services from design, installation and maintenance to a number of clients. Due to sheer growth they are seeking a security small works engineer to work within the Hackney area.
Salary Package
- £35,000 – £40,000
- 40 hour week
- Company van – fuel card
- Travel time – give 45 minutes each way
- Call out rota – £100 standby
- Overtime
- 22 days holidays & bank holidays
Duties
- Small works on door entry, access control, CCTV systems
Area of Cover
- Hackney
Qualifications
- Relevant qualifications
